Bug#162042: ITP: ntlmproxy -- NTLM authorization proxy server



On Mon, Sep 23, 2002 at 01:55:28PM +0200, martin f. krafft wrote:
> Package: wnpp
> Version: N/A; reported 2002-09-23
> Severity: wishlist

> * Package name    : ntlmproxy
>   Version         : 0.9.8
>   Upstream Author : Dmitrz Rozmanov <dima@xenon.spb.ru>
> * URL             : http://www.geocities.com/rozmanov/ntlm/
> * License         : GPL
>   Description     : NTLM authorization proxy server

> This can apparently be used to allow NTLM authentication with M$ Proxy
> Server and IIS Web Servers even when employing a sane browser (i.e.
> not IE).

> Packages are being created.

Just as a comment, I think it would be much better if NTLM auth (and
other NTLMSSP auth types -- such as Kerberos) support was integrated into
browsers directly.  Of course, this means someone has to write an NTLM
client implementation that's license-compatible with Mozilla, so in the
meantime this package certainly sounds useful.
